Trial and Tested
In the celestial realm, where Dharmaraj Chitragupta posed his profound question to Archer Arjuna, the scene was imbued with a serene yet weighty atmosphere. They stood amidst celestial gardens, where the air was fragrant with the scent of divine blossoms, and the distant melodies of celestial musicians provided a soothing backdrop.
Chitragupta, with his characteristic wisdom, looked into Arjuna's eyes, which reflected the turmoil of his thoughts. "Arjuna," he began, his voice carrying the weight of his righteous soul, "if given the choice, where would your heart dwell? In the splendor of Heaven or amidst the trials of Hell?"
Arjuna, the valiant warrior whose bowmanship had earned him divine laurels, looked pensively into the horizon. His mind was a battlefield of contemplation, where emotions and logic clashed like warring armies. After a moment of introspection that seemed to stretch across epochs, he finally spoke with the clarity of one who had seen both the heights of glory and the depths of despair.
"My noble sir" Arjuna replied, his voice resonating with the echoes of countless battles and the echoes of divine wisdom imparted by Lord Krishna, "Heaven's blissful gardens and celestial pleasures are undeniably enticing. Yet, it is not in Heaven's splendor that the heart finds its truest test."
Chitragupta nodded knowingly, understanding the depth of Arjuna's words. "Indeed, Arjuna. The trials of Hell may seem daunting, yet it is there, amidst adversity and challenge, that our virtues are forged and our souls refined."
Arjuna's gaze turned resolute as he continued, "I have fought in battles where the very fabric of righteousness and justice was tested. I have seen sorrow and loss, and yet through it all, I have found strength not in the tranquility of Heaven, but in the crucible of struggle."
Chitragupta smiled warmly, his admiration for Arjuna's unwavering spirit evident. "Your words resonate with the wisdom that only experience can impart, dear Arjuna. It is not the realm in which we find ourselves, but the steadfastness of our hearts and the nobility of our actions that define our journey."
As the sun dipped below the horizon, casting a golden hue over the celestial gardens, Arjuna and Chitragupta stood together in silent contemplation. The heavens above seemed to nod in approval, bearing witness to the timeless wisdom exchanged between two souls bound by duty, honor, and an unwavering commitment to righteousness.
And thus, in the timeless realm of divinity, amidst the beauty of Heaven's serenity, Arjuna reaffirmed his resolve to tread the path of righteousness, wherever it may lead—be it in Heaven's embrace or amidst the trials of Hell. For true love, he knew, resides not in a place, but in the courage and conviction of the heart.
